Chaplin's Patent Portable Steam Engines
and Smoke Burning Boilers,
On the Forced Combustion Principle,
fig. 3. £ig. a .
STEAM CRANE.
The great strength, extreme simplicity, and lightness of these Engines, render them peculiarly (
suitable for agricultural purposes, and for use in situations where Steam Engines of the ordinary con- 1 1
struction have never before been applied.
The STATIONARY ENGINES {Fig, 1) require no building in nor chimney stalk, and, with tbe»
forced Combustion Apparatus, will burn wood or peats.
Prices of Stationary Engines and Boilers as above, complete in every respect, delivered in Glasgow.
2 Horse Power, £fi5. I 5 Horse Power, £124. I 11 Horse Power, £180.
3 „ „ £80. 7 „ „ £147. 13 „ „ £210.
4 „ „ £100. 9 „ „ £165. I 16 „ „ £250.
And up to 30-horse power.
These Engines male Portable on Truck Carriage {Fig. 2) 12J per cent, extra,
LIGHT ROADWAY ENGINES (Fig. 3), with new "Patent Tubular Boilers " aiid Double
Cylinders, Horse Trams, &c. complete, on a pair of road wheels.
Prices, complete, delivered in Glasgow.
4-borse power, £425. ; 6-horse power, £150. ; 8-horse power. £200.
If on four roadway wheels, the front pair to swivel, Horse Trams, &c: — 10-horse power, £248. ;
14-horse power, £294.; 1 8-horse power, £330.
SELF-PROPELLING and TRACTION ENGINES on the same principle up to 50-hors»
power, to draw any required weight at a proportionate speed.
CONTRACTORS' LOCOMOTIVES (Fig. 4), of a very light and efficient construction, suitable
for Rails or Tramways of a gauge from 2^ feet and upwards.
Further particulars on application at the Works, where a variety of these Engines, and other Steam
Engines, &c. on Chaplin's Patent Construction, may be seen.
